Screening of Acetic Acid-Producing Bacteria from Coffee Pulping Process and Their Efficiency in Malt Vinegar Production
Bacterial isolate which can produce acetic acid has been isolated from a coffee pulping process. Primary screening of acetic acid-producing bacteria was performed by using YPG medium.
